Richard D. Ludescher has had a multi-disciplinary academic career, studying anthropology and philosophy at the University of Iowa (B.A. '73), chemistry at the University of Oregon (Ph.D. '84), and muscle biophysics at the University of Minnesota, before accepting a position in food chemistry in 1988 at the Department of Food Science, Rutgers University—New Brunswick where he is currently a full professor. In addition to running a research program in food physical chemistry and optical biophysics and teaching courses in the physical properties of foods, he has served as Undergraduate Program Director (1993-1998) and Director of the Graduate Program (2000-2003) in Food Science, as Campus Dean for Undergraduate Education on the George H Cook Campus (2006-2011), and since 2011 as the Dean for Academic Programs at the Rutgers School of Environmental and Biological Sciences. While at Rutgers he has won numerous teaching awards at the department, school, university, and national levels.
